What the Research Says — Beginner-Friendly Summary

A growing body of clinical reports, case series, and controlled trials supports the biologic rationale and therapeutic benefits of growth factor and cytokine concentrates for equine soft-tissue and joint injuries. Evidence indicates these concentrates can enhance tissue repair pathways, reduce pro-inflammatory signaling, and improve subjective and objective functional outcomes when used as part of a comprehensive treatment plan. Outcomes vary by product type (autologous PRP or APS, conditioned serum like IRAP, and laboratory-produced recombinant formulations), injury chronicity, and application technique. Safety profiles are generally favorable when proper preparation and aseptic technique are used; product validation for potency and stability improves predictability of clinical response.

Mechanism: Concentrates deliver higher local levels of growth factors (eg, PDGF, TGF-beta) and modulatory cytokines to accelerate cell recruitment, matrix synthesis, and angiogenesis while downregulating excessive inflammation.

Product types: Autologous options (PRP, APS, IRAP) minimize immune risk and are popular in field settings; recombinant or lab-produced cytokine concentrates offer standardized dosing and longer shelf life.

Clinical evidence: Peer-reviewed case series and controlled trials report accelerated tendon and ligament healing, reduced joint inflammation, and improved lameness scores when biologics are used alongside rehabilitation.

Safety and handling: Studies emphasize the importance of validated potency, sterility, and correct storage; point-of-care systems reduce preparation variability but require operator training.

Practical considerations: Choice depends on injury type, timing (acute vs chronic), availability of on-site processing, cost, and regulatory status in Canada.
